日志信息处理系统、日志信息处理方法及装置和交换机制造方法及图纸

技术编号:26530757 阅读:18 留言:0更新日期:2020-12-01 14:10
本申请公开了一种日志信息处理系统,包括:可编程逻辑器件、管理处理器、主处理器;所述主处理器,用于将所述主处理器的串口数据发送到所述可编程逻辑器件;所述可编程逻辑器件,用于将所述主处理器的串口数据进行镜像,获得串口镜像信息;所述管理处理器,用于获得所述可编程逻辑器件输出的主处理器的串口镜像信息,并将所述串口镜像信息记录到日志文件中。采用上述方法,以解决现有技术存在的不能保存主处理器的串口日志信息或者保存日志信息时缺乏灵活性的问题。

【技术实现步骤摘要】
日志信息处理系统、日志信息处理方法及装置和交换机
本申请涉及计算机
,具体涉及一种日志信息处理系统,本申请还涉及一种日志信息处理方法和日志信息处理装置,本申请还涉及一种交换机。
技术介绍
数据中心交换机是数据中心网络的核心部件,它的可靠性和可用性决定了网络是否稳定。交换芯片处理整个交换机的数据流量的转发,交换机的HostCPU(主处理器)对交换芯片进行控制和配置,HostCPU的串口输出是交换机的一个重要信息来源,运维人员可以通过这个信息来查看HostCPU的历史打印信息和对交换机故障、异常进行诊断。特别地,当HostCPU挂死时可以通过之前的串口打印获取CPU挂死前的信息,帮助定位故障或异常产生的原因。因此保存完整的CPU串口日志非常重要。现有技术下,一些数据中心交换机系统没有内置HostCPU(主处理器)串口的日志保存功能,一旦HostCPU挂死很难发现挂死之前HostCPU的串口打印输出和发生的问题。另外一些数据中心定制的交换机虽然支持串口日志的保存,但是由于系统只有一个处理器既负责控制也负责管理,串口日志完全依靠可编程逻辑来进行提取和保存,当需要查看日志内容或者备份历史日志时都需要暂停日志保存任务,无法保证日志的完整性;因此不能随时查看日志文件,缺乏灵活性。综上所述,现有技术存在不能保存主处理器的串口日志信息或者保存日志信息时缺乏灵活性的问题。
技术实现思路
本申请提供一种日志信息处理系统,以解决现有技术存在的不能保存主处理器的串口日志信息或者保存日志信息时缺乏灵活性的问题。本申请提供一种日志信息处理系统,包括:可编程逻辑器件、管理处理器、主处理器;所述主处理器,用于将所述主处理器的串口数据发送到所述可编程逻辑器件;所述可编程逻辑器件,用于将所述主处理器的串口数据进行镜像,获得串口镜像信息;所述管理处理器,用于获得所述可编程逻辑器件输出的主处理器的串口镜像信息,并将所述串口镜像信息记录到日志文件中。可选的,所述管理处理器具体用于:启动日志进程;利用所述日志进程将所述串口镜像信息记录到所述日志文件中。可选的,所述管理处理器具体用于:将所述日志文件保存到非易失性存储介质中。可选的,所述管理处理器具体用于:将所述日志文件传送到日志服务器。可选的,所述管理处理器具体用于:通过带外管理网络将所述日志文件传送到日志服务器。可选的,所述管理处理器具体用于:当所述日志文件的大小达到或超过预设的文件大小阈值时,将所述日志文件传送到日志服务器。可选的,所述可编程逻辑器件,还用于:获取主处理器的串口数据。可选的,所述可编程逻辑器件,还用于:将所述串口镜像信息传送给交换机的面板串口。可选的,所述可编程逻辑器件具体用于:将所述串口镜像信息传送给管理处理器的日志记录串口。本申请还提供一种日志信息处理方法,包括:获得可编程逻辑器件输出的主处理器的串口镜像信息;将所述串口镜像信息记录到日志文件中。可选的,所述将所述串口镜像信息记录到日志文件中,包括:启动日志进程;利用所述日志进程将所述串口镜像信息记录到所述日志文件中。可选的,还包括:将所述日志文件保存到非易失性存储介质中。可选的,还包括:将所述日志文件传送到日志服务器。可选的,所述将所述日志文件传送到日志服务器,包括:通过带外管理网络将所述日志文件传送到日志服务器。可选的,所述将所述日志文件传送到日志服务器,包括:当所述日志文件的大小达到或超过预设的文件大小阈值时,将所述日志文件传送到日志服务器。可选的,还包括:对所述串口镜像信息进行处理,获得符合日志文件格式的日志信息;所述将所述串口镜像信息保存到所述日志文件,包括:将所述符合日志文件格式的日志信息保存到所述日志文件。可选的,所述将所述符合日志文件格式的日志信息保存到所述日志文件包括:判断符合日志文件格式的日志信息中的日志记录的日志记录等级是否大于或等于预设的日志记录等级阈值;若是,将所述符合日志文件格式的日志信息保存到所述日志文件。本申请还提供一种日志信息处理方法,包括:获取主处理器的串口数据;将所述主处理器的串口数据进行镜像,获得串口镜像信息;将所述串口镜像信息传送给管理处理器。可选的,还包括:将所述串口镜像信息传送给交换机的面板串口。可选的,所述交换机的可编程逻辑器件将所述串口镜像信息传送给交换机的管理处理器,包括:将所述串口镜像信息传送给管理处理器的日志记录串口。本申请还提供一种日志信息处理装置,包括:串口镜像信息获得单元,用于获得可编程逻辑器件输出的主处理器的串口镜像信息;串口镜像信息记录单元,用于将所述串口镜像信息记录到日志文件中。本申请还提供一种日志信息处理装置,包括:主处理器的串口数据获取单元,用于获取主处理器的串口数据;串口镜像信息获得单元,用于将所述主处理器的串口数据进行镜像,获得串口镜像信息;串口镜像信息传送单元,用于将所述串口镜像信息传送给管理处理器。与现有技术相比,本申请具有以下优点:本申请提供一种日志信息处理系统,通过可编程逻辑器件将所述主处理器的串口数据进行镜像,获得串口镜像信息;并将串口镜像信息传送给管理处理器;管理处理器将串口镜像信息保存到交换机的日志文件,实现了对主处理器串口数据的保存,方便数据中心网络运维人员对交换机和主处理器的诊断。本申请第一实施例与完全依赖可编程逻辑实现的串口日志保存的方案相比,通过管理处理器保存串口日志具有更高的灵活性,可以随时查看日志文件,并且不会中断日志的保存,保证了日志的完整性。附图说明图1是本申请提供的一种应用场景的示意图。图2是本申请第一实施例提供的一种日志信息处理系统的示意图。图3是本申请第二实施例提供的一种日志信息处理方法的流程图。图4是本申请第三实施例提供的一种日志信息处理方法的流程图。图5是本申请第四实施例提供的一种日志信息处理装置的示意图。图6是本申请第五实施例提供的一种日志信息处理装置的示意图。具体实施方式在下面的描述中阐述了很多具体细节以便于充分理解本专利技术。但是本专利技术能够以很多不同于在此描述的其它方式来实施,本领域技术人员可以在不违背本专利技术内涵的情况下做类似推广,因此本专利技术不受下面公开的具体实施的限制。在介绍具体实施方式前,先介绍一下本申请用到的一些技术术语。交换机:一种用于电(光)信号转发的网络设备。BMC(BaseboardManagementController):管理处理器,在交换机中用于管理电源、温感和异常监控的处理器。HostCP本文档来自技高网...

【技术保护点】
1.一种日志信息处理系统,其特征在于,包括:可编程逻辑器件、管理处理器、主处理器;/n所述主处理器,用于将所述主处理器的串口数据发送到所述可编程逻辑器件;/n所述可编程逻辑器件,用于将所述主处理器的串口数据进行镜像,获得串口镜像信息;/n所述管理处理器,用于获得所述可编程逻辑器件输出的主处理器的串口镜像信息,并将所述串口镜像信息记录到日志文件中。/n

【技术特征摘要】
1.一种日志信息处理系统,其特征在于,包括:可编程逻辑器件、管理处理器、主处理器;
所述主处理器,用于将所述主处理器的串口数据发送到所述可编程逻辑器件;
所述可编程逻辑器件,用于将所述主处理器的串口数据进行镜像,获得串口镜像信息;
所述管理处理器,用于获得所述可编程逻辑器件输出的主处理器的串口镜像信息,并将所述串口镜像信息记录到日志文件中。


2.根据权利要求1所述的日志信息处理系统,其特征在于,所述管理处理器具体用于:
启动日志进程;
利用所述日志进程将所述串口镜像信息记录到所述日志文件中。


3.根据权利要求1所述的日志信息处理系统,其特征在于,所述管理处理器具体用于:
将所述日志文件保存到非易失性存储介质中。


4.根据权利要求1所述的日志信息处理系统,其特征在于,所述管理处理器具体用于:
将所述日志文件传送到日志服务器。


5.根据权利要求4所述的日志信息处理系统,其特征在于,所述管理处理器具体用于:
通过带外管理网络将所述日志文件传送到日志服务器。


6.根据权利要求4所述的日志信息处理系统,其特征在于,所述管理处理器具体用于:
当所述日志文件的大小达到或超过预设的文件大小阈值时,将所述日志文件传送到日志服务器。


7.根据权利要求1所述的日志信息处理系统,其特征在于,所述可编程逻辑器件,还用于:
获取主处理器的串口数据。


8.根据权利要求1所述的日志信息处理系统,其特征在于,所述可编程逻辑器件,还用于:
将所述串口镜像信息传送给交换机的面板串口。


9.根据权利要求1所述的日志信息处理系统,其特征在于,所述可编程逻辑器件具体用于:
将所述串口镜像信息传送给管理处理器的日志记录串口。


10.一种日志信息处理方法,其特征在于,包括:
获得可编程逻辑器件输出的主处理器的串口镜像信息;
将所述串口镜像信息记录到日志文件中。


11.根据权利要求10所述的日志信息处理方法,其特征在于,所述将所述串口镜像信息记录到日志文件中,包括:
启动日志进程;
利用所述日志进程将所述串口镜像信息记录到所述日志文件中。


12.根据权利要求10所述的日志信息处理方法,其特征在于,还包括:
将所述日志文件保存到非易失性存储介质中。


13.根据权利要求10所述的日志信息处理方法,其特征在于,还包括:
将所述日志文件传送到日志服务器。


14.根据权利要求13所述的日志信息处理方法,其特征在于,所述将...

【专利技术属性】
技术研发人员:黄一元王超姚志平陈亮朱芳波陈明煊
申请(专利权)人:阿里巴巴集团控股有限公司
类型:发明
国别省市:开曼群岛;KY

网友询问留言 已有0条评论
  • 还没有人留言评论。发表了对其他浏览者有用的留言会获得科技券。

1